It needs little experience on the stream to real ize that this sympathy and converse with nature in her myriad forms of air, sky, woods, water, and the teeming life of bird and brute and fish, are a great part of the boundless delight of the angler's silent trade.

These mysterious influences and attractions of nature impart to the use of the rod a refinement and fascination which elevate it above the rank of a merely gross, illiberal, and vulgar sport.

This is verified in the instances of many noted persons who, while swaying masterly seep tres over the minds of men, have yet also lovingly plied angling-rods in the secluded and quiet streams.
